Mutation details: The mouse Tyr promoter was used to drive expression of a Th chimeric minigene composed of a mouse genomic fragment containing exons 1 and 2, rat cDNA containing sequence from exons 2 to 11, and mouse genomic sequence for exons 11 to 13. The Th minigene is deposited in GenBank as AY855842. An IRES element linked the Th construct to Gch1. Six founders were identified. Founder line 6775 contained four copies of the transgene and expressed the highest eye-specific tyrosine hydroxylase levels.
(J:105984)
